**Q: How does Pennant handle notification fan-out backpressure?**

Pennant applies per-channel token buckets and sheds load by deferring low-priority pushes to a durable overflow queue. No notification payloads are dropped silently; all deferrals are audit-logged with tenant scope. Overflow queues are encrypted at rest and purged after seven days. For the full threat-model writeup, contact the fan-out service owner.

billing contact of yawip-yadup = druath.casdor@nelvrolabs.internal

The PointsLedger API in Brindlewick Rewards now exposes accrual hooks to plugin authors, so please note the rounding change in this revision. Fractional points are truncated at posting time, not at redemption, which means your plugin's preview totals must match the ledger's truncation order or customers will see off-by-one balances. Expiry sweeps also moved to a nightly batch, so avoid assuming real-time expiry in your handlers. The defaults your plugins inherit are listed below.

tuning table, kajog-bawip:
TIERS = {
    "kelius": 256,
    "lammir": 543,
}

Step 6 covers hardening the bounce processor in Larkspool before it touches production mail streams. The processor parses inbound bounce notifications, classifies them as hard or soft, and updates suppression lists; for the security review, note that message bodies are discarded after classification and only hashed recipient tokens are persisted. Parsing runs in a sandboxed worker with no outbound network access. The processor reads its runtime configuration at startup, reproduced in full below.

settings of bawif-fawif:
ralix:
  log_level: warn
  metrics_host: metrics.ralix.tolvaqsys.internal
  pool_size: 32